An influencer posted a video on YouTube initially had 50 views as soon as was posted. The total number of views exponentially increases by 42% every hour. h represents time measured in hours since the video was posted. How many views after 24 hours? * follow the principle of rounding up or down can't be determined O 23,861 O 1.335419285x10^17 O 1,193,049
